...number of units to be produced...? Crystal Telecom has budgeted sales of its innovative mobile phone for the next four months as follows:
Sales in Units
July - 30,000
August - 45,000
September - 60,000
October - 50,000
The company is now in the process of preparing a production budget for the third quarter. Past experience has shown that end-of-month inventory levels must equal 10% of the next month's sales. The inventory at the end of June was 3,000 units.
Prepare a production budget for the third quarter; in your budget show the number of units to be produced each month and for the quarter in total.
